Thursday just wasn't the day for Jennings County's offense. They came up short against the New Albany Bulldogs on Thursday, falling 8-0. While losing is never fun, the Panthers can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Indiana soccer rankings (they are ranked 276th, while the Bulldogs are ranked 90th).
Jennings County has been struggling recently as they've lost ten of their last 12 mat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 1-12-3 record this season. As for New Albany, the victory made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 7-6-3.
The two teams are set to take part in some playoff action in their next matches. Jennings County will square off against Floyd Central at 5:00 p.m. on Monday. As for New Albany, they will face off against Seymour at 7:00 p.m. on Wednesday. Seymour will roll in looking for their sixth straight win, something New Albany surely won't give up without a fight.
